Output 51fd1362d2109649b4efbcbf0a105d82b170644cc572d164c5c756f2b00d9339:0
- value
- 382449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1df97c96aebf8d21fc016bb8db16de6fd81afeaa OP_EQUAL
- address
- 34RWPk9xU41b4vaztvC3KBhF1P5Cw3Kkuz
- transaction
- 51fd1362d2109649b4efbcbf0a105d82b170644cc572d164c5c756f2b00d9339